Job: Senior Communications Specialist

Location: Manila 
Deadline: Friday, 25 October 2013 

Description
Job Purpose:
Lead ADB's communications approaches on social networking. Ensure close monitoring and supervision of social media feeds relevant to ADB messages. Monitor and interpret social media comments and build the capacity of staff on active and maximize social media utilization. Provide analysis and recommendations to support the dissemination of information on select ADB-supported projects/programs. Support the Strategic Communications and Media Relations (SCMR) team leader in the day-to-day work of the team and oversee the management of the team in the absence of the team leader. Serve as communications focal point to assigned departments/offices. Work within general policies, principles and goals, working directly with clients.
Expected Outcomes
Social Media /Networking and Strategic Communications
  • Lead the implementation of ADB's Social Media strategy and ensure all activities related to social media are timely and accurately executed.
  • Oversee the maintenance and update of ADB social media accounts such as Facebook, Twitter, blogs and other platforms.
  • Ensure ADB brand and messages are highlighted and well discussed on social media platforms.
  • Develop and moderate regular discussions on Twitter and Facebook.
  • Ensure up to date and regular information on all ADB major activities are uploaded on social media platforms.
  • Work closely with the Web team, to ensure consistency of messages on other web platforms and social media.
  • Oversee tracking, monitoring, and interpretation of social media comments.
  • Provide analysis and recommendations for the development of communications strategies.
Coordination and Support
  • Coordinate and serve as focal point to assigned departments/offices and advice departments/offices on communications approaches.
  • Manage relationships with international, regional and local media in assigned area(s) and identify media opportunities for Senior Management and other ADB staff.
  • Prepare press releases, statements, key messages, opinion pieces and other materials as required.
  • Represent the Department in various interdepartmental working groups in support of ADB-wide initiatives, particularly on social media and networking, as required.
  • Act as Officer-in-Charge of SCMR team, when needed.
Knowledge Sharing
  • Conduct capacity building programs for ADB staff, especially those in the field offices, on active social media utilization; share relevant knowledge to benefit the broader ADB community.
  • Ensure key knowledge products are widely disseminated through a variety of channels.
  • Contribute to and support the preparation and conduct of related in-house seminars and workshops.
Staff Supervision
  • Supervise a team of communications staff to achieve key ADB objectives in the areas of social networking.
  • Provide leadership and support to reporting staff.
  • Supervise the performance of reporting staff and consultants, providing clear direction and regular monitoring and feedback on performance.
  • Ensure the ongoing learning and development of reporting staff.
Educational Requirements:
Master's Degree, or equivalent, in Communications, Journalism, Marketing, or related fields. University degree in Communications, Journalism, Marketing, or related fields combined with specialized experience in similar organization/s, may be considered in lieu of a Master's degree.
Relevant Experience And Other Requirements:
Work experience
  • At least 10 years' relevant experience within the field in a professional capacity.
Technical knowledge
  • In-depth knowledge and experience of social media, media and corporate communications.
  • Demonstrated utilization of vast social media platforms and knowledgeable in current social networking trends, particularly using digital and web platforms
  • In-depth knowledge and exposure in media relations and other aspects of corporate communications
People and leadership skills
  • Act as a mentor to team members, providing guidance on the delivery of services
  • Act as a coach to develop capabilities/potential of more junior colleagues
